Columbia Leather Cleaning Experts

We understand how different types of leather require a different cleaning and care process.  We provide the safest and most effective cleaning for all types of leather furniture including: 

  •     Aniline – Also called natural, pure, naked or unprotected leather
  •     Protected – Also called finished semi–aniline, every day, pigmented and painted           leather
  •     Nubuck – Also referred to as chaps, distressed, bomber and suede leather


Properly cleaned and maintained leather furniture will last four or five times longer than that made of fabric or man–made fibers. Over the years such contaminants as sweat and body oils, skin acids, dust, spills and other debris will become ground into leather upholstery. There are many cleaning products available which are not appropriate for leather furniture cleaning.  In fact, they may cause more damage than good, causing dryness and cracking.
